Government Employees Health Association, Inc. (G.E.H.A) is a nonprofit member association that provides health and dental benefits that millions of federal employees and retirees, military retirees and their families have counted on since 1937. Offering one of the largest health and dental benefit provider networks available to federal employees in the United States, G.E.H.A empowers health and wellness by meeting its members where they are, when they need care.
G.E.H.A has one mission: To empower federal workers to be healthy and well.
The Manager, Dental Network Oversight leads the strategic oversight of G.E.H.A's dental network performance across dental lines of business, ensuring the network delivers measurable value through strong access, network adequacy, savings performance, provider availability, and partner accountability. This role serves as a strategic business owner for the dental network oversight function, evaluating owned and contracted network performance, identifying opportunities to improve affordability and competitiveness, and advancing recommendations that support member value, regulatory commitments, and long-term business objectives. The Manager partners closely with Dental Product, the Connection Dental Network (CDN) team, the Third-Party Administrator (TPA), analytics, procurement, legal, compliance, and operational leaders to align network priorities, drive performance improvement, and ensure issues are addressed with clear ownership and measurable outcomes. Provider escalation governance is managed as an input to broader network oversight, using recurring themes to strengthen partner performance, reduce operational friction, and inform sustainable network improvement. As the function evolves, this role will help shape the future network oversight operating model, including scalable processes, governance structure, role clarity, training needs, and readiness for future people-leadership responsibilities.

Duties and Responsibilities:
- Lead the dental network oversight function for G.E.H.A, establishing governance routines, performance expectations, savings monitoring, access reviews, partner accountability, reporting standards, and executive-ready action tracking across CDN, TPA, and internal stakeholders.
- Own dental network adequacy performance for G.E.H.A's dental members, using access metrics by geography, specialty, and product line to direct network development priorities and close gaps for G.E.H.A Connection Dental Federal through the Federal Employees Dental and Vision Insurance Program (FEDVIP) and Connection Dental Plus (CD+).
- Evaluate G.E.H.A's owned and contracted dental network model to determine whether current network strategy supports access, affordability, competitiveness, specialty coverage, provider availability, savings performance, and regulatory expectations.
- Identify and quantify network savings opportunities by analyzing utilization patterns, reimbursement trends, fee schedule performance, provider participation, market dynamics, and member value.
- Serve as the primary strategic point of accountability between Dental Product and the CDN team, aligning dental network priorities, resolving competing objectives, and ensuring network decisions support program performance and enterprise goals.
- Hold internal and external partners accountable for agreed-upon outcomes, ensuring performance concerns are escalated appropriately, corrective actions are implemented, and improvements are sustained through clear governance and follow-up.
- Support network expansion and market evaluation activities by defining business needs, assessing partner or market options, contributing to evaluation criteria, and coordinating limited RFP-related input when additional network solutions are required.
- Advance network innovation opportunities, including quality-focused approaches, provider performance models, improved access strategies, data-driven oversight tools, and capabilities that support affordability, transparency, and provider experience.
- Oversee provider complaint and escalation governance by ensuring recurring themes are analyzed, ownership is assigned, root causes are addressed, and escalation insights inform strategic network decisions.
- Develop executive-level dashboards, scorecards, and leadership updates that communicate network performance, savings opportunities, access risks, escalation themes, open issues, recommended actions, and decision points.
- Anticipate network-related risks to G.E.H.A's dental program performance and drive mitigation plans with defined owners, timelines, measurable outcomes, and appropriate leadership visibility.
- Shape the future network oversight operating model by defining core functions, documenting scalable processes, identifying staffing needs, developing training materials, and preparing the function for future people-leadership responsibilities as it expands.
